    Our client, a leading organization in electrical infrastructure and manufacturing support, is seeking a Substation Technician to join their team. As a Substation Technician, you will be part of the Electrical Maintenance Department supporting high-voltage substation operations. The ideal candidate will demonstrate strong technical skills, attention to detail, and a proactive approach to safety, which will align successfully in the organization.

     

    **Job Title:** Substation Technician

    **Location:** El Paso, Texas

    **Pay Range:** $95000 - $110000

     

    What's the Job?

     

    + Perform installation, preventive maintenance, and corrective repairs on substation components, transformers, switchgear, and protective relays.

    + Diagnose and repair electrical issues using testing devices and a variety of hand and power tools, including responding to after-hours outages to restore service.

    + Conduct inspections and electrical testing of substation equipment to ensure optimal performance and compliance with applicable codes and safety standards.

    + Execute switching operations, load transfers, and equipment isolation in accordance with established lockout/tagout (LOTO) and electrical safety procedures.

    + Maintain accurate and detailed maintenance records, test results, and work logs for compliance and operational tracking.

     

    What's Needed?

     

    + Bachelor’s degree in electrical engineering, Industrial Maintenance, or a related field.

    + Minimum 5 years of experience in high-voltage substation maintenance, repair, or operations (15kV–230kV+).

    + Demonstrated expertise in interpreting electrical schematics, blueprints, and one-line diagrams.

    + Strong knowledge of OSHA 10/30, NFPA 70E, NEC, and lockout/tagout safety procedures.

    + State or Journeyman Electrician License preferred.
